Arizona moved its Strategic Digital Asset Reserve Act through a House vote, while Tennessee’s Bitcoin-only reserve proposal is scheduled for a Finance Committee hearing on April 21.

Fact Check
The Arizona portion is supported by the official Arizona Legislature page "SB1373 - 571R - H Ver - Arizona Legislature," which shows the bill as a House-engrossed Senate bill for a digital assets strategic reserve fund, consistent with the statement that Arizona moved a reserve proposal through a House vote. Additional Arizona context from "SB1025 - 571R - House Bill Summary - Arizona Legislature" shows related reserve legislation existed, though its specific name is "Arizona Strategic Bitcoin Reserve Act," not "Strategic Digital Asset Reserve Act." This means the user statement is directionally correct but somewhat imprecise on naming. The Tennessee portion is supported by Tennessee General Assembly search evidence tied to "Bill Information - Tennessee General Assembly" and the snippet for "Senate Sponsor List - Tennessee General Assembly," which states SB2639, the Tennessee Strategic Bitcoin Reserve Act, was placed on the Senate Finance, Ways, and Means Committee calendar for 4/21/2025. Because the Tennessee bill page could not be directly fetched and the Arizona act name differs from the exact phrasing in the claim, confidence is medium rather than high.

Terms & Concepts
  • Strategic digital asset reserve: A government-held pool of digital assets intended for treasury management or long-term holding.
  • Bitcoin-only reserve: A reserve structure focused exclusively on holding Bitcoin rather than a broader mix of digital assets.
